parent
ff74305623
commit
29a579e43a
@ -0,0 +1,21 @@ |
||||
#!/bin/sh |
||||
# |
||||
# Copyright (C) 2010 OpenWrt.org |
||||
# |
||||
|
||||
. /lib/functions/uci-defaults.sh |
||||
. /lib/cns21xx.sh |
||||
|
||||
board=$(get_board_name) |
||||
|
||||
case "$board" in |
||||
"ns-k330") |
||||
ucidef_set_led_netdev "eth_orange" "ETH (orange)" "ns-k330:orange:eth" "eth0" |
||||
ucidef_set_led_usbdev "usb1" "USB1" "ns-k330:green:usb1" "1-1" |
||||
ucidef_set_led_usbdev "usb2" "USB2" "ns-k330:green:usb2" "1-2" |
||||
;; |
||||
fi |
||||
|
||||
ucidef_commit_leds |
||||
|
||||
exit 0 |
@ -1,42 +0,0 @@ |
||||
#!/bin/sh |
||||
# |
||||
# Copyright (C) 2010 OpenWrt.org |
||||
# |
||||
|
||||
. /lib/cns21xx.sh |
||||
|
||||
board=$(get_board_name) |
||||
|
||||
ns_k330_set_leds() { |
||||
uci batch <<EOF |
||||
set system.led_eth_orange='led' |
||||
set system.led_eth_orange.name='eth_orange' |
||||
set system.led_eth_orange.sysfs='ns-k330:orange:eth' |
||||
set system.led_eth_orange.trigger='netdev' |
||||
set system.led_eth_orange.dev='eth0' |
||||
set system.led_eth_orange.mode='link' |
||||
set system.led_eth_green='led' |
||||
set system.led_eth_green.name='eth_green' |
||||
set system.led_eth_green.sysfs='ns-k330:green:eth' |
||||
set system.led_eth_green.trigger='netdev' |
||||
set system.led_eth_green.dev='eth0' |
||||
set system.led_eth_green.mode='tx rx' |
||||
set system.usb_led1=led |
||||
set system.usb_led1.name='USB' |
||||
set system.usb_led1.sysfs='ns-k330:green:usb1' |
||||
set system.usb_led1.trigger='usbdev' |
||||
set system.usb_led1.dev='1-1' |
||||
set system.usb_led1.interval='50' |
||||
set system.usb_led2=led |
||||
set system.usb_led2.name='USB' |
||||
set system.usb_led2.sysfs='ns-k330:green:usb2' |
||||
set system.usb_led2.trigger='usbdev' |
||||
set system.usb_led2.dev='1-2' |
||||
set system.usb_led2.interval='50' |
||||
commit system |
||||
EOF |
||||
} |
||||
|
||||
if [ "${board}" == "ns-k330" ]; then |
||||
ns_k330_set_leds |
||||
fi |
Loading…
Reference in new issue